Is it legal to carry a loaded firearm in your vehicle in Utah without a concealed firearm permit?

In Utah, it is legal to carry a loaded firearm in your vehicle without a concealed firearm permit as long as the firearm is visible. This means that the firearm should be in plain sight and not concealed within the vehicle. It is important to note that if the firearm is concealed, then a concealed firearm permit would be required to carry it legally in the vehicle.
